Case Summary: A.B.A. /3147/2026 The Jharkhand High Court granted anticipatory bail to Sonu Ram, aged 29, who faced apprehension of arrest in a forest offence case (Complaint Case No. 233 of 2021) involving alleged cultivation of poppy plants on forest department land under Section 33(1)(C) of the Indian Forest Act, 1927. The petitioner contended the allegations were false and the land did not belong to him, while the State opposed the bail prayer. Justice Sanjay Kumar Dwivedi approved anticipatory bail considering the circumstances, directing the petitioner to surrender within three weeks and to furnish bail bonds of Rs. 25,000 with two sureties of equal amount each, subject to standard conditions under the BNSS, 2023.
